Nonlinear mixed effects models for comparing growth curves for Guzerá cattle

Abstract: The objective of the present work was to evaluate the accuracy of the fitted Gompertz and von Bertalanffy models for male and female Guzerá cattle, respectively. Four production regions in Northeast Brazil were included in the models as a fixed effect, and the animals were included as a random effect. In addition, the coefficients of the growth models in the production regions were compared.
